Things to see and do in Bedford
Natural spaces are in plentiful supply in and around Bedford, thanks in part to the River Great Ouse which flows through the heart of town. You can follow the river for some wonderful walks, while spots like Russell Park make great use of their riverside setting. Bedford Park is also located close to the centre of town, along with Priory Country Park.
Little Paxton Pits, meanwhile, is a charming nature reserve set over almost 80 hectares just a 20-minute drive from town. Back on your doorstep you can explore the history and culture of the local area by visiting Bedford Castle, the Stockwood Discovery Centre and the Higgins Art Gallery and Museum, while the Shire Hall, Panacea Museum and John Bunyan Museum are all must-sees in the centre of town.
Education
Bedford Girls’ School on the south bank of the river close to the town centre is one of the very best schools in the local area. Bedford Modern School just north west of the centre is highly rated too, as well as De Parys Avenue’s Bedford School. If you’re looking for primaries, Cauldwell School on Edward Road and Great Denham Primary are among the top central options, while areas like Great Denham and Wixams also have strong local schools.
Transport links in Bedford
Carbon-free travel in Bedford is easily possible thanks to a network of cycling routes, while there are also plenty of bus routes and two train stations you can get around with. If you have a car, the town is served by the A6 and A421 roads, which you can use to get to places like Kettering and Luton in little time, in addition to the A1 and M1.
